  /**
   * The meaning of the path of a classpath entry depends on its entry kind:<ul>
   <li>Source code in the current project (<code>CPE_SOURCE</code>) -
   *      The path associated with this entry is the absolute path to the root folder. </li>
   <li>A binary library in the current project (<code>CPE_LIBRARY</code>) - the path
   *    associated with this entry is the absolute path to the JAR (or root folder), and
   *    in case it refers to an external JAR, then there is no associated resource in
   *    the workbench.
   *  <li>A required project (<code>CPE_PROJECT</code>) - the path of the entry denotes the
   *    path to the corresponding project resource.</li>
   <li>A variable entry (<code>CPE_VARIABLE</code>) - the first segment of the path
   *      is the name of a classpath variable. If this classpath variable
   *    is bound to the path <it>P</it>, the path of the corresponding classpath entry
   *    is computed by appending to <it>P</it> the segments of the returned
   *    path without the variable.</li>
   <li> A container entry (<code>CPE_CONTAINER</code>) - the first segment of the path is denoting
   *     the unique container identifier (for which a <code>ClasspathContainerInitializer</code> could be
   *   registered), and the remaining segments are used as additional hints for resolving the container entry to
   *   an actual <code>IClasspathContainer</code>.</li>
   */
  public IPath path;

  /**
   * Validate a given classpath and output location for a project, using the following rules:
   * <ul>
   *   <li> Classpath entries cannot collide with each other; that is, all entry paths must be unique.
   *   <li> The project output location path cannot be null, must be absolute and located inside the project.
   *   <li> Specific output locations (specified on source entries) can be null, if not they must be located inside the project,
   *   <li> A project entry cannot refer to itself directly (that is, a project cannot prerequisite itself).
   *   <li> Classpath entries or output locations cannot coincidate or be nested in each other, except for the following scenarii listed below:
   *      <ul><li> A source folder can coincidate with its own output location, in which case this output can then contain library archives.
   *                     However, a specific output location cannot coincidate with any library or a distinct source folder than the one referring to it. </li>
   *              <li> A source/library folder can be nested in any source folder as long as the nested folder is excluded from the enclosing one. </li>
   *       <li> An output location can be nested in a source folder, if the source folder coincidates with the project itself, or if the output
   *           location is excluded from the source folder. </li>
   *      </ul>
   * </ul>
   *
   *  Note that the classpath entries are not validated automatically. Only bound variables or containers are considered
   *  in the checking process (this allows to perform a consistency check on a classpath which has references to
   *  yet non existing projects, folders, ...).
   *  <p>
   *  This validation is intended to anticipate classpath issues prior to assigning it to a project. In particular, it will automatically
   *  be performed during the classpath setting operation (if validation fails, the classpath setting will not complete).
   *  <p>
   * @param javaProject the given java project
   * @param rawClasspath a given classpath
   * @param projectOutputLocation a given output location
   * @return a status object with code <code>IStatus.OK</code> if
   *    the given classpath and output location are compatible, otherwise a status
   *    object indicating what is wrong with the classpath or output location
   */
